The story of the Dark X Script in Lumber Tycoon 2 is a defining chapter in the game's long-standing battle with its own economy. While Lumber Tycoon 2 was designed to reward players for their individual hard work, the rise of powerful exploits like Dark X fundamentally shifted the game's community culture toward mass duplication and "modded" bases. The Rise of Dark X

Dark X emerged as a comprehensive "all-in-one" script that democratized complex exploits for the average player. Before its widespread use, duplication often required tedious, manual glitches involving multiple devices or specific character-reset timings.

Automation: Dark X automated these processes, allowing users to duplicate items like rare axes and high-value wood (such as Phantom Wood or Sinister Wood) with a single click.

GUI Accessibility: The script featured a specialized Graphical User Interface (GUI) that included "OP" features like auto-buying, instant wood milling, and base-stealing.

Platform Reach: It became particularly notorious for its mobile compatibility, allowing a massive influx of mobile players to participate in the game's "underground" economy. The Impact on the Economy

The script's efficiency led to a permanent shift in the Lumber Tycoon 2 Wiki community:

Item Devaluation: Traditionally rare items, such as numbered Christmas ball gifts, lost much of their prestige as duped copies flooded servers.

The "Modded" Era: High-level play transitioned from chopping wood to trading "modded" items—objects that were chemically or physically altered through client-side cheats to have massive sizes or impossible colors.

Developer Demotivation: By 2018, the scale of exploiting enabled by tools like Dark X was so large that the game's creator, Defaultio, became visibly demotivated, slowing the frequency of major updates to focus on other projects. The Current State

Despite the massive influx of exploits, the game remains one of the top experiences on Roblox, having surpassed 1.2 billion visits by 2026.

The world of Lumber Tycoon 2 on Roblox has always been a unique blend of peaceful tree-farming and a cutthroat player economy. However, nothing has shaped the game's culture quite like the emergence of Dark X Scripts. These scripts represent a significant "gray area" in gaming—where the desire for efficiency meets the controversial world of game exploitation. The Allure of Efficiency

At its core, Lumber Tycoon 2 is a "grind" game. Moving logs, processing wood, and earning money for better axes can take hundreds of hours of manual labor. This is where Dark X comes in. By offering features like Auto-Farm, Teleportation, and Instant Wood Processing, these scripts allow players to bypass the repetitive mechanics that define the game. To many, it isn't about "cheating" in a competitive sense; it’s about reaching the "end-game" content—like building massive, intricate bases—without the months of tedious wood-chopping. The Duplication Economy

The most impactful (and controversial) feature of the Dark X script is the Duplication (Dupe) glitch. In a game where rare items like the Many Axe or Alpha Axe are no longer obtainable through normal play, the ability to duplicate items becomes a cornerstone of the player-driven market.

The Pro: It makes rare, high-tier items accessible to new players who missed out on seasonal events.

The Con: It triggers massive hyper-inflation. When an item that should be one-of-a-kind is duplicated thousands of times, its value plummets, often ruining the sense of achievement for "legit" collectors. The Ethics of Scripting

While Dark X provides a playground of infinite resources, it fundamentally changes the nature of the game. Lumber Tycoon 2 was designed as a slow-burn experience. When a script removes the challenge, it often removes the longevity of the game. Once a player has everything, they often find they have nothing left to do. Furthermore, using these scripts carries a high risk of account bans from Roblox or blacklisting by the game's developer, Defaultio. Conclusion

Dark X Scripts are a double-edged sword. They empower players to build masterpieces and bypass the grind, but they also destabilize the game's economy and risk the player's standing within the community. Whether seen as a tool for creativity or a shortcut that ruins the spirit of the game, their presence in the Lumber Tycoon 2 ecosystem is an undeniable part of its history.
